Finally, Some Pictures

August 21st 2007
I finally have some pictures for you today. We wen´t to Quito´s old town in the morning, looked at some nice buildings, saw a demonstration (one guy looked like Amir Perez), and then went up to El Panecillo, which is a small hill that overlooks Quito.
